Since I have to get my maintenance from Sun, I won't be able to use the whole
patch. Do you think it's feasible that I could un-tar the patch and just
extract the NetWare NLMs from that and save them off? Hey ... if it's worth a
shot, I'll try it.

> I posted this a while back and have continued to search but still I've found
> no
> definitive information on how to obtain the latest and greatest client
> software
> for NetWare clients being backed up by NBU 3.2GA. My clients are at least 2
> years old and the bpcd.nlm tends to abend my NetWare servers every once in a
> while. It's never the same server all the time and the frequency is completely
> random. Someone on this list pointed me to a current patch that did some
> things
> with regard to NetWare but there is still no mention of the actual client
> software. I'm running NBU 3.2GA on a Sun E450 under Solaris 2.6 and the
> NetWare
> clients are not downloaded to the Sun server during the install. I have to
> install each client individually, which leads me to believe, they will not be
> included in any patch package I get from Sun.
>
> Anybody got any ideas? The chore of rebooting a couple of servers after my
> weekly FULL backups is getting kind of old now. I'd like to fix this and be
> done
> with it. I'm planning on upgrading to NBU 3.4 later this year, but that won't
> help me in the here and now.

I've downloaded and loaded updated NetWare NetBackup NLMs from the
download sections of VERITAS' website. In the 3.2 section under
'downloads' (http://support.veritas.com/menu_ddProduct_NETBACKUP.htm)
there are no patches posted anymore and the only thing NetWare related
are updated PDF files. I imagine you'd have to contact VERITAS for more
current 3.2 NetWare patches.
For 3.4 I've downloaded NetWare patches from the downloads section at
http://support.veritas.com/menu_ddProduct_NETBACKUPDC.htm. If you do
this, WATCH OUT. Just double-click the patch file to expand it in an
empty directory. From there DO NOT run 'setup.exe', it will willy-nilly
copy over all the NetBackup NLMs to every system you mapped to SYS:\ to
without any confirmation. Instead, just manually copy over the updated
NLMs as you would for a new installation.
You are missing out on a lot of fixes for NetWare NetBackup by not
upgrading to 3.4.
